This study investigates the intermolecular interactions between the transporter protein bovine serum albumin (BSA) and the antitumor drug Lorlatinib using multispectral approaches and molecular simulations. By analyzing fluorescence quenching, UV-visible spectroscopy, and molecular docking, the research aims to understand the binding mechanism, thermodynamics, and structural changes involved in the BSA-Lorlatinib complex. The combination of experimental techniques with computational simulation provides valuable insights into the drug's transport, bioavailability, and potential therapeutic implications, offering a detailed picture of how Lorlatinib interacts with serum proteins.
